Abstract

The utility model discloses a steering limiting mechanism of a four-wheel scooter, which belongs to the technical field of scooters and comprises a turnover mechanism, wherein the upper end of the turnover mechanism is connected with a steering column, a plurality of through holes are formed in the middle of the turnover mechanism, the turnover mechanism is connected with a mandrel through a plurality of through holes through bolts, and limiting parts are symmetrically arranged at the bottom of the turnover mechanism; the lower end of the turnover mechanism is provided with a pipe column lower end seat, the outer wall of the pipe column lower end seat is provided with a limiting installation surface, and the limiting installation surface is provided with a steering limiting block. According to the steering limiting mechanism, the steering limiting mechanism is optimized, and the limiting part is abutted by the steering limiting block to limit the rotation angle of the turning mechanism, so that the rotation of the steering column is limited, and the purpose of limiting the rotation angle of the steering wheel is achieved.

Steering limiting mechanism of four-wheel scooter
Technical Field
The utility model belongs to the technical field of scooters, and particularly relates to a steering limiting mechanism of a four-wheel scooter.
Background
The four-wheel scooter is used as a tool for playing and cross-country functions, the rotation angle of the steering wheel is required to be limited properly, so that when the steering angle is overlarge, the tire is prevented from interfering with the frame, or when the steering angle is smaller, the turning radius is smaller, therefore, the space of the vehicle is properly utilized, and the proper steering angle and the adjustable steering angle are particularly important.
The existing steering limiting mechanism is complex to install or limited by only one bolt, and after a long time, the existing steering limiting mechanism is serious in abrasion and not accurate enough in limitation.
Therefore, the utility model provides a steering limiting mechanism of a four-wheel scooter, which aims to solve the problems in the prior art.

Referring to fig. 1-2, in an embodiment of the utility model, a steering limit mechanism of a four-wheel scooter comprises a turnover mechanism 1, wherein the upper end of the turnover mechanism 1 is connected with a steering column, a plurality of through holes 12 are formed in the middle of the turnover mechanism 1, the turnover mechanism 1 is connected with a mandrel 5 through the through holes 12 by bolts, and limit parts 11 are symmetrically arranged at the bottom of the turnover mechanism 1;
the lower end of the turnover mechanism 1 is provided with a pipe column lower end seat 4, the outer wall of the pipe column lower end seat 4 is provided with a limit installation surface 41, the limit installation surface 41 is provided with a steering limit block 3, and the steering radius of the limit part 11 is larger than the intrados radius of the steering limit block 3, so that when the turnover mechanism 1 rotates, the steering limit block 3 can form abutting connection with the limit part 11 to limit the rotation of the turnover mechanism 1.
Compared with the prior art, the steering limiting mechanism of the four-wheel scooter provided by the embodiment of the utility model optimizes the steering limiting mechanism, and the steering limiting block 3 is abutted against the limiting part 11 to limit the rotation angle of the turnover mechanism 1, so that the rotation of a steering column is limited, and the purpose of limiting the rotation angle of steering wheels is achieved.
In this embodiment, a U-shaped hole is formed in the middle of the steering stopper 3, and the steering stopper 3 is detachably connected to the stopper mounting surface 41 by inserting a fastening bolt 2 into the U-shaped hole.
In one embodiment, the steering limiting block 3 is of an arc-shaped structure, one side of the steering limiting block 3 with a shorter radian is close to the turnover mechanism 1, and the front and rear positions of the steering limiting block 3 on the lower end seat 4 of the pipe column are adjusted through changing the angles of the two sides of the steering limiting block 3 or through U-shaped holes, so that the rotation angles of different wheels are limited, and the situation that when the steering angle is too large, tires interfere with a frame or when the steering angle is smaller, the turning radius is smaller is avoided.
Further, the bottom of the turnover mechanism 1 is overlapped with the lower end seat 4 of the pipe column.
